Durability and Maintenance

Both materials are durable, but Baccarat Stone X2 edges out when it comes to maintenance.

Granite, while tough, requires sealing every few years to keep it looking fresh.

With Baccarat, you can clean it without fuss, no seals necessary.

Cost Considerations

Ah, the dreaded cost discussion.

Neither Baccarat Stone X2 nor granite is exactly budget-friendly, like deciding between two expensive desserts.

On average, granite countertops range from $40 to $100 per square foot.

By contrast, Baccarat Stone X2 can be priced slightly higher, but its durability might just save you money in the long run.
